>    If the things you are adding are not in sort order, then you no longer
> really want the collection to be sorted.  You could use a concatenated
> collection to join the new items while the others remain sorted like I did
> in this post:
> http://blogs.adobe.com/aharui/2008/03/custom_ilists_combobox_prompts.html
>
>
>
> Or you can simply grab the old dataprovider via toArray() into a new
> collection without a sort and add your new items at the beginning.

> Is there any way to add new items to the top of a sorted datagrid?
> I know how to add stuff to a datagrid/provider, but am unsure about how to
> keep the new item at the top of the datagrid and not have the underlying
> sort kick-in.
